started this after noon getting my ko3 turbo out ready for a ko3s, ive got all the bolts out of the turbo, left the manifold on, disconnected oil retun pipe, drained the coolant, its just hanging on now by something, ive disconnected the coolant pipes i just cant seem to find where it was hanging on to ?? so im going have another go tommorrow i have completely removed the downpipe and exhaust, i no its got an oil feed somewhere and i havent actually found this, could this be what it is hanging by? can anybody give me advice on this please :)

Oil and coolant feed is on top of the turbo.

Theres a supporting bracket underneath the turbo thats attached to the block :wink:
